VANCOUVER, Nov. 28, 2011 /CNW/ - Tyhee Gold Corp. (TSX Venture: TDC) (the "Company") announces that it has received the final results from its 10,000 metre (m) diamond drill program at Clan Lake. Results include CL209 which had an exceptional 885 gram per tonne (gpt) gold intercept within a 20 metre wide mineralized zone grading 24.71 gpt (uncut). This drilling was focused on the Clan Main Zone, filling a gap between two mineralized areas.

"The results show that the Main Zone continues to be open to the southeast, while drilling a gap within the Main Zone returned very good numbers including a short interval that was close to 0.1% gold (885 gpt)," reports Dr. Dave Webb, President & CEO. "These high-grade intercepts are not unusual in Yellowknife, and are typically reduced to 100 gpt in any engineering calculation so as to not put too much emphasis on a single assay. This is industry standard practice." Field operations have been suspended for freeze-up, however engineering and permitting work continues.

Tyhee Gold Corp. is actively moving its wholly-owned Yellowknife Gold Project towards production. A Feasibility Study, lead by SRK Consulting, is underway and expected to be completed by mid-2012. It will build on the positive Preliminary Feasibility Study completed in July 2010, which recommended operating at 3,000 tonnes per day. The Feasibility Study will also consider an expanded resource as well as other updated inputs, including a more current gold price.
